FRAZER LATEST SUCCESS OF ROAD TO INDY PARTNERSHI­P

- By Richard Gee. Photos by Bruce Jenkins.

Pukekohe teenager Billy Frazer is the latest young Kiwi racing driver to head to the United States to take the next steps of his career, his move to the USF2000 Series this year thanks in no small part to the Castrol Toyota Racing Series and its Road to Indy partnershi­p.

Castrol Toyota Racing Series drivers who have competed in all rounds of the 2020 and 2021 championsh­ip – and that includes Kiwi Driver Fund-supported Frazer – automatica­lly qualify for a package that could help them get establishe­d in the programme. This includes free entry for either the annual two-day spring training test or the two-day Chris Griffis Memorial test along with a free set of tyres for a test in either a USF2000 or Indy Pro 2000 single-seater.

Organisers of the TRS championsh­ip had hoped that two to three drivers would have been able to compete in the series this year from the US and that a significan­t number of TRS drivers would make the trip to the USA as part of the Road to

Indy programme, but travel restrictio­ns and the pandemic have proved a formidable obstacle.

“It is a very challengin­g environmen­t for these sorts of partnershi­ps with so much restrictio­n on travel,” explained category manager Nico Caillol. “However, Billy represents a major success in the partnershi­p and a strong show of intent from both ourselves and the Road to Indy programme that we want to continue to build this relationsh­ip and provide a pathway in both directions for up and coming single seater racing drivers.”

Although adjusted due to the Covid-19 pandemic, the USF2000 calendar will continue to offer a strong mix of road, street, and oval events for drivers – the majority at INDYCAR events.

The 2021 USF2000 champion will receive a substantia­l scholarshi­p guaranteei­ng a full season contract with an Indy Pro 2000 team of the driver’s choice including all 2022 race and test events, entry and test day fees and allowable number of sets of Cooper tyres. The scholarshi­p also includes an Indy Lights test at the conclusion of the 2021 Indy Pro 2000 season.
